Cinnamon Toast Crunch Sugar Cookies

  • Author: Dan
  • Prep Time: 30
  • Cook Time: 10
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 24 Cookies 1x

Cinnamon Toast Crunch Sugar Cookies are my son’s new cookie recipe creation! It’s a delicious sugar cookie topped with a crispy and sweet “toast” topping!

Scale

Ingredients

For the Cookies

  • 6 cups flour
  • 4 sticks butter at room temperature
  • 2 cups white s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 3 teaspoons vanilla
  • 3 teaspoons baking powder

For the Topping

  • 1 1/2 cups panko bread crumbs, toasted until lightly brown in a dry skillet
  • 1 cup white sugar combined with 2 tablespoons cinnamon
  • 1 egg beaten with a teaspoon of water

Instructions

  1.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. Cream the butter and sugar together in the bowl of a stand mixer.
  3. Add the eggs and vanilla, scraping down the sides of the bowl as needed.
  4. Put the miser on low and add the flour in batches until the dough comes together.
  5. Divide the dough in half, then starting with one half roll the dough out on a floured surface until the dough is about 1/4′ thick.
  6. Using a cookie cutter, cut out the dough and place the shapes onto the prepared baking sheet.
  7. Repeat until the dough is gone then chill the trays in the refrigerator for 20 minutes.
  8.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
  9. Lightly brush the tops of the cookies with egg wash.
  10. Coat the tops while the egg wash is still wet with the panko bread crumbs, lightly pushing them into the cookie.
  11. Generously sprinkle the cinnamon/sugar mixture over the tops of the cookies and bake for 10 – 12 minutes.
